What role will you play?

You will perform the regulatory licensing, registration, and designation staff members. You will maintain accurate records, deliver relevant reporting, prepare and submit regulated entity filings and manage regulatory payments and allocations. In addition, you will assist with other information requests and various ad hoc tasks and projects as required.

What you offer:

  • 2-3 years of demonstrated experience in a registrations role or investment banking, regulatory or legal environment.
  • Knowledge of securities laws and financial services regulation.
  • Ability to work to deadlines, independently manage varied assignments, maintain a critical focus to detail and potential risk.
  • Excellent written and communication skills.
  • Ability to liaise with various levels of stakeholders, including senior personnel.

About the Risk Management Group

In our Risk Management Group, you will be part of an independent, and centralised function, responsible for independent and objective review and challenge, oversight, monitoring and reporting in relation to Macquarie's material risks. Our divisions include behavioural risk, compliance, credit, financial crime risk, internal audit, market risk, operational risk and governance, prudential risk, and Risk Management Group central.
